#17e3c9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#17e3c9 is composed of 9% red, 89%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.5%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 172.4 degrees, a saturation of 81.6% and a lightness of 49%. #17e3c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#2effff with #00c793.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#17e3c9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#17e3c9 has RGB values of R:23, G:227,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 1565641.

Hex triplet 17e3c9 #17e3c9
RGB Decimal 23, 227, 201 rgb(23,227,201)
RGB Percent 9, 89, 78.8 rgb(9%,89%,78.8%)
CMYK 90, 0, 11, 11
HSL 172.4°, 81.6, 49 hsl(172.4,81.6%,49%)
HSV (or HSB) 172.4°, 89.9, 89
Web Safe 00cccc #00cccc
CIE-LAB 81.474, -50.642, -0.071
XYZ 38.361, 59.333, 64.686
xyY 0.236, 0.365, 59.333
CIE-LCH 81.474, 50.642, 180.08
CIE-LUV 81.474, -64.747, 7.861
Hunter-Lab 77.028, -45.903, 4.13
Binary 00010111, 11100011, 11001001

Shades and Tints of #17e3c9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d0c is the darkest color, while #fafffe is the lightest one.
